Boosted Board back in August of this year while living in New York City. It was an awesome purchase. It is fun to ride and I could often beat the subway to my destination on shorter trips. I have since moved to Silicon Valley and find the range to be lacking slightly. The board gets approximately 7 miles of range out of the box and my office is 10 miles from home.

I added 288Wh of high-discharge lithium-ion batteries to the 99Wh of batteries that came with the board. I was inspired by the
Portable Electric Vehicle Youtube Channel. During the first test ride I was able to ride more than 13 miles before stopping. The fuel gauge on the remote showed more than 20% of battery remaining.
